MOOCs and Open Education is a
edited collection
that
discusses
topics
regarding open
educational resources
and
massive open online courses (MOOCs).
Brand new
advances in
blended learning technology enable
people
in nations all around the world
to be participants in classes online.
These massively open online courses are
commonly free
for learners but do not
consistently
lead to formal accreditation.
There are several
issues that
elearning technology institutions
must deal with
more than ever because elearning technology is
advancing so quickly.
How can participants
certify that
the quality of instruction provided by these
massive open online courses is
passable?
How can we
assure that
lecturers are properly credentialed
and qualified to teach MOOCs?
What business strategies are being used by
organizations like
One Month to conduct these MOOC classes?
What experimental evaluation strategies and teaching practices are in use today?
How can we
handle issues like
poor
motivation and high
learner attrition?
As online learning technology becomes more
widespread there is a
increasing
desire
to better understand how
these MOOC courses are being conducted.
Educators
and many other
participants
would like
to be more aware of
the outcomes of these
intriguing new open educational
undertakings.
Completion rates for online MOOCs are far less than the completion rates for traditional courses.
Scientists want
to gain more knowledge about how
these massively open online courses
can be made better.
To satisfy this
increasing
need for
information
the inspiring new book
MOOCs and Open Education
offers a critical analysis of
these massively open online courses and other open educational subjects.
This stimulating new book
also articulates the
most important controversies associated with
these MOOC courses and open educational resources (OERs).
